Scope1.1 This specification covers flanged U-channel carbon s

    3、teelposts having a nominal weight ranging from 0.75 to 6.0 lb/ftand a nominal width ranging from 1.25 to 4.0 in. These postsare furnished in the as-wrought condition intended for appli-cations requiring high tensile strength or crashworthiness andwith a lower carbon (LC) designation for use where hi

    4、gherductility or improved weldability are required. These materialsare available in multiple yield strength levels of 50, 60, 70, and80 ksi (345, 420, 485, and 550 MPa). The 50- and 60-ksi (345-and 420-MPa) yield strength grades are available as lowercarbon posts, designated as Grades 50LC or 60LC.N

    5、OTE 1This specification does not cover high-strength low-alloy(HSLA) post. Refer to Specification A572/A572M for HSLA. Forstructural Grade 36, refer to Specification A36/A36M.1.2 UnitsThe values stated in inch-pound units are to beregarded as the standard. The values given in parentheses aremathemat

    6、ical conversions to SI units that are provided forinformation only and are not considered standard.1.3 This standard does not purport to address all of thesafety concerns, if any, associated with its use. Ordering Infor

    17、mation4.1 Orders for material under this specification shouldinclude the following information:4.1.1 Quantity (weight or number of pieces);4.1.2 Name of material (steel posts);4.1.3 Grade of steel (Grades 50, 50LC, 60, 60LC, 70, or 80);4.1.4 Weight per foot;4.1.5 Condition (as-rolled, painted, powde

    18、r coated, or gal-vanized);4.1.6 Hole punching, if required;4.1.7 ASTM designation and date of issue;4.1.8 Certification, if required (Section 11);4.1.9 Product marking; and4.1.10 Product packaging and package marking.NOTE 2A typical ordering description is as follows: 1000 pieces,flanged u-channel p

    19、ost, Grade 60, 8 ft (2.4 m) long, 2 lb (0.9 kg) per foot,as-rolled, ASTM AXXXX dated _.5. Materials and Manufacture5.1 FeedstockMaterial may be manufactured from re-rolled rail steel or rolled from billet steel.5.2 Material produced from rerolled rails shall be made toconform to Specification A499.5

    20、.3 Material produced from billet steel shall be made by thecommercially available steel-making processes.5.4 Posts shall be supplied in the hot rolled condition, unlessotherwise specified in the purchase order.6. Chemical Composition6.1 Material rerolled from rails shall conform to the chem-istry re

    21、quirements of Specification A1, as the chemistry is notsignificantly changed by the hot rolling process.6.2 Material rolled from billets shall conform to the require-ments prescribed in Table 1.6.2.1 The heat analysis report shall be furnished to thepurchaser.6.2.2 By agreement between the purchaser

    22、 and supplier,limits can be established for elements or compounds notspecified in Table 1.6.2.3 The product analysis shall be permitted to vary fromthe heat analysis according to the limits established in Table Aof Specification A6/A6M.7. Mechanical Properties7.1 RequirementsThe material as represen

    23、ted by the testspecimens shall conform to the tensile requirements specifiedin Table 2.7.2 Test SpecimensTest specimens may be taken from afull section or a machined section.7.2.1 Sub-sized tensile specimens shall be taken from theflat part of the U-shaped section.7.3 Test MethodTensile tests shall

    24、be made in accordancewith Test Methods and Definitions A370.8. Dimensions, Mass, and Permissible Variations8.1 DimensionsBecause of differences in mill facilities,tolerances of post sections vary among the manufacturers andsuch tolerances are subject to agreement between manufacturerand purchaser.8.

    25、2 Weight per Unit LengthThe permissible variation forweight per foot shall be in accordance with the requirementsspecified in Table 3.8.3 LengthThe permissible variations for length shall bein accordance with the requirements specified in Table 4.8.4 StraightnessVariations in straightness shall not

    26、exceed0.25 in. in any 5 ft 4 mm in any meter or 0.25 in. numberof feet of length divided by 5 4 mm number of metres oflength.9. Finish, Condition, and Appearance9.1 Surface FinishThe posts shall have a commercialhot-wrought finish obtained by conventional hot rolling. Theposts shall be free of injur

    27、ious defects, such as, but not limitedto, seams, scabs, inclusions visible to the unaided eye, laps,splits or slivers.9.2 ConditionPosts can be furnished as-rolled, painted,coated, or galvanized as specified by the purchaser.9.2.1 When specified by the purchaser to be galvanized, theposts shall be z

    28、inc coated in accordance with SpecificationA123/A123M.10. Number of Tests and Retests10.1 One tension test shall be made from each heat.10.2 When the heat or lot is produced to multiple sizes(varying by more than 10 % in weight per foot), tensile testsshall be performed on the thickest and thinnest

    29、material rolledfrom that heat.TABLE 1 Chemical RequirementsAGrades Carbon ManganesePhosphorus,maxSulfur,maxSiliconStandard 0.550.84 0.601.10 0.035 0.040 0.100.50LC 0.220.55 0.300.90 0.035 0.040 0.100.50AOther alloying elements not specified in Table 1 may be typically added at thediscretion of the p

    30、roducer, but shall be reported in the heat analysis.TABLE 2 Mechanical RequirementsGrade 50LC 60LC 50 60 70 80Yield strength,min, ksi (MPa)50(345)60(415)50(345)60(415)70(485)80(550)Tensile strength,min, ksi (MPa)70(485)80(550)80(550)90(620)95(655)110(760)Elongation in 8 in or200 mm, min, %12 10 5 5

    31、5 5Elongation in 2 in or50 mm, min, %14 12 7 7 7 7TABLE 3 Permissible Variations in Weight per Unit LengthPermissible Variations from Specified Size, %5 % of ordered weight per unit length before subsequent manufacturingprocessing such as hole punchingA1075 12 (2017)1210.3 Retesting for failed mecha

    32、nical properties shall bepermitted in accordance with Specification A29/A29M.11. Rejection and Rehearing11.1 Material that fails to conform to the requirements ofthis specification shall be rejected in accordance with theprocedures of Specification A29/A29M.
